Calling all Warhawks: Operation: Broken Mirror is dated and priced

Recommended Videos

 Fresh on the heels of Sony’s surprise announcement that Warhawk would be offered with a limited-time discount ($29 until 4/15), comes the official release date for the game’s latest expansion pack, Operation: Broken Mirror

 According to Sony’s blog, the pack will be available for purchase on the PlayStation Store on April 17th, and will set you back $7.99. You can watch the video and see for yourself, but here’s what parting with that hard-earned cash entitles you to:  

  • -10 bonus layouts for battlefields from the original game, so you can play with APCs.
  • -10 layouts on Vaporfield Glacier, a new Winter battlefield.
  • -2 new Armored Personnel Carriers (Chernovan and Eucadian styles).
